Foundation Overview
Based in Lighthouse Point, FL, Tim And Linda Oconnor Family Foundation has awarded 85 grants totaling $395,900 to organizations in Maine, Florida and 5 other states, plus international recipients. Individual grants range from $500 to $24,000, with a median award of $4,000.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
-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
-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
-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
-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
